## Environment Variables: Digest Scheduling

The Plumeria digest scheduler batches outbound email per tenant, honoring each tenant's local send window and a global concurrency ceiling of 40 workers. Schedules are computed hourly; missed windows roll forward rather than double-send. The scheduler authenticates to the Thornfield mail relay on every batch, and that credential is set by the following line:

secret setting of yafof-tawep: RELAY_SECRET8=8abb5772

Changed defaults in Splitfork, our assignment service. Bucketing now uses sticky hashing per account instead of per session, and the holdout slice grew from 2% to 5%. Callers relying on session-level reassignment must opt in explicitly. Review the diff against the new baseline; the updated default configuration is listed below.

config for tagep-kajof:
[casir]
port = 6379
region = south-1
host = casir.paliqdyn.example
team = tamax
timeout_ms = 250
retries = 2

## Webhook Delivery

The Tindervale parcel-tracking service pushes scan events to customer endpoints via signed webhooks. Deliveries are at-least-once: if an endpoint returns a non-2xx status or times out, the event is requeued with exponential backoff until the retry budget is exhausted, after which it moves to the dead-letter queue for manual replay. As a new contractor, the main thing to internalize is the retry schedule, governed by these constants.

constants for faduf-yawip:
PRIORITIES = {
    "kelion": 462,
    "ulaeth": 830,
}

## Onboarding: Bulk Edits (Lanternfell Admin)

Quick context for the eng sync: bulk edits in the admin orders table go through a queued job, capped by `BULK_EDIT_MAX_ROWS=500`. Larger selections are chunked automatically. Edits are audited; never bypass the queue with direct SQL. The job worker signs each audit batch using a signing secret, which the environment file sets on the next line.

secret setting of hawep-yahig: LEDGER_TOKEN29=41b5d6315371c92885eaeb077fb63

Contractors attending Wexbourne House at weekends should note that both passenger lifts are routinely taken out of service for maintenance between Saturday morning and Sunday evening. Tools and materials must therefore be moved via the goods hoist at the rear loading dock, which remains operational but locked. Access to the hoist lobby requires the code below.

staff pass of haweg-bafop = bdg-G-69